Significado
Those who make loud threats rarely follow through with them.
Contexto cultural
In the monsoon-dependent regions of North India, the arrival of rain is crucial. Thunder without rain is a source of disappointment, making the metaphor very relatable. In modern Indian offices, this proverb is frequently used to describe managers who use aggressive 'management by fear' tactics. Political rallies are often filled with loud speeches. This proverb is a common critique used by opposition parties or cynical voters. Parents often use this to teach children not to be intimidated by bullies at school.
Don't change the gender
Even if you are talking about a woman, keep the proverb in the masculine plural form. It is a fixed saying.
Use it to comfort
This is a great phrase to use when a friend is stressed about a bully. It shows you are calm and wise.
